.section{margin-left:auto;margin-right:auto;max-width:1250px;padding:4.375rem 1rem}.text-sand{color:#d8a45c;font-weight:500}.bg-gradient-to-b{bottom:0px;left:0px;position:absolute;right:0px;top:0px}.h1--sub--heading{color:#ab5a33;display:block;font-family:Arial;font-size:0.85rem;font-weight:600;letter-spacing:0.2em;line-height:1rem;text-transform:uppercase}.home--line{background-color:#ab5a33;height:1px;width:3rem}.grid--2{column-gap:4rem;display:grid;grid-template-columns:repeat(2,minmax(0,1fr));row-gap:3rem}.text--h2{font-size:1.225rem;line-height:1.625}.heading--h2{color:#ffffff;font-family:Times New Roman;font-size:3rem;font-weight:700;line-height:1;margin-bottom:2rem}.heading--h3{font-family:Times New Roman;font-size:1.7rem;font-weight:700;line-height:2rem;margin-bottom:1rem}.heading-center{align-items:center;display:flex;flex-direction:column;margin-bottom:5rem;margin-left:auto;margin-right:auto;max-width:48rem;width:100%}.heading--h2--center{color:#2b3020;font-family:Times New Roman;font-size:3.75rem;font-weight:700;line-height:1;margin-bottom:1.5rem}